Supervise data, documents, and signatures to ensure smooth arrivals

Keeping check-ins up to date not only prevents last-minute issues but also gives you peace of mind and control over your guests’ arrivals. With Online Check-in, you can easily review, validate, and correct information quickly and efficiently.

How to manage an online check-in

In the module VRMS → Bookings → Booking list, open the corresponding booking and go to the “Online Check-in” tab. From there, you can:

  • View a summary of all guests’ check-ins.

  • Check the status of each check-in.

  • Review data, documents, and signatures (according to your configuration).

  • Validate that the provided information is correct. If it isn’t, you can invalidate the check-in so that the guest can complete it again.

Check-in statuses in the booking record

  • Requested: The guest has not yet completed the check-in.

  • Pending: All occupants have completed their check-in, but they require review. You must validate or invalidate them. The system records the date of the last modification made by the guest.

  • Validated: All check-ins have been confirmed. The system records the validation date and the user who performed the action.

Invalidate a check-in with incorrect data

If the information provided by the guest doesn’t match (for example, the document number doesn’t correspond to the photo), you can invalidate the check-in.

  • You must write a note to the guest indicating what needs to be corrected.

  • The guest will receive a notification with the information to be fixed.

  • Once corrected, the VRMS notification system will alert you to review the check-in again.

Check the status of multiple check-ins

If you want to get a list of all bookings for the upcoming week and see which ones have completed their online check-in, use the “Online Check-in status” filter in the Booking list and select the desired status or statuses. This allows you to organize and prioritize validation efficiently.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know which bookings have completed the check-in?

Pending check-ins appear with an orange circle, and the system records the date of the guest’s last modification. Validated ones are marked with a green circle, along with the date and the staff member who performed the validation.

Can I invalidate a check-in?

Yes. If the data doesn’t match, you can invalidate it. The guest will receive a notification to correct the information.

How can I filter bookings by their check-in status?

In the VRMS Booking list module, use the Check-in status filter to display bookings that are in Pending or Validated status.
